def process_midi_message(self, message: Message) -> None:
"""
Process an incoming MIDI message during learning.
Handles NOTE_ON (velocity > 0) and NOTE_OFF messages.
Automatically advances the step when a note-off is received.
:param message: Mido Message object
"""
if self.state != PatternLearnerState.LEARNING:
return
try:
if message.type == MidoMessageType.NOTE_ON.value and message.velocity > 0:
self._handle_note_on(message)
elif message.type == MidoMessageType.NOTE_OFF.value or (
message.type == MidoMessageType.NOTE_ON.value and message.velocity == 0
):
self._handle_note_off(message)
except Exception as ex:
log.error(
message=f"Error processing MIDI message: {ex}",
scope=self.scope,
)

def _find_row_for_note(self, midi_note: int) -> Optional[int]:
"""
Find the row that corresponds to a MIDI note.
Uses the MIDI converter if available, otherwise falls back to hardcoded ranges.
:param midi_note: MIDI note number
:return: Row index (0-3) or None if note doesn't match any row
"""
if self.midi_converter:
for row in range(self.config.total_rows):
if self.midi_converter.is_note_in_row_range(row, midi_note):
return row
return None
# Fallback to hardcoded ranges
ranges = {
0: range(60, 72), # C4 to B4 (Digital Synth 1)
1: range(60, 72), # C4 to B4 (Digital Synth 2)
2: range(48, 60), # C3 to B3 (Analog Synth)
3: range(36, 48), # C2 to B2 (Drums)
}
for row, note_range in ranges.items():
if midi_note in note_range:
return row
return None
